    Get a code reader, 54 plate diesel should be fully OBDII compliant. Get a code reader with live data
    so you can see things like fuel pressure and throttle position, EGR etc.

    Get one cheaper than paying a dealer for a diagnostic.

    You are mistaken, they are both 'error' lights on a Corsa, the engine one is a more serious light indicating a problem which could cause (I think) cat damage. You can drive on a spanner light but must stop on an engine light.

    This tutorial will tell you simply how to check any fault codes logged in yourcar, in a cheap cost effective way without the hassle of paying a garage £50 for a diagnostic check

    Tools
    No specialist tools are needed, only 2 working feet are required, 30 seconds of your time and pen & paper to write down the codes

    STEP 1:

    Get inside yourvehicle a firmly place yourself in your seat. Once in, press both the accelerate and brake pedal together

    STEP 2:

    With both pedals pressed, put your key in the ignition and turn it to position 2, which is the position that switches all auxilary heating on but not the engine

    STEP 3:

    Once done, the spanner light will start flashing

    if it flashes 10 times it means the number is '0' and any other flashes corresponds to a number with a pause between each number

    for example code P0110
    the light will flash ten times then pause (2sec Or 1 not sure) flash once, (2sec pause) flash once, (2 sec pause) then flash ten times


    if you have more than one code it will stop for a break between each code


    however if you don’t have any code stored it will start Flashing and keeps on flashing until you release the pedals

    If you follow the above steps you are certain to find codes without ever having to plug an OBD equipment
